Drontal Worming Suspension is recommended for the control of gastrointestinal worms in puppies and small dogs including Roundworm, Hookworm, Whipworm. This product does not control Tapeworms or heartworms.
Roundworms and Hookworms:
These parasites infect puppies while still in the mother's womb or as soon as they suckle the milk. Hookworms are bloodsuckers and in large numbers are capable of causing anaemia and death, particularly in puppies.
Due to the life cycle of these worms it is important to treat puppies frequently until at least 12 weeks of age. Both worms can also infect dogs of any age by ingestion of worm eggs and larvae can also penetrate through the skin.
To reduce general environment contamination by eggs and larvae from the bitch during pregnancy, pregnant bitches should be treated routinely prior to mating, and at the end of pregnancy and during lactation.
Whipworms:
This parasite lives in the large intestine and is transmitted by the eggs, passed onto the ground by one dog, being ingested by another dog. The eggs are extremely resistant and long lasting. It is important to treat every 6-8 weeks after 3 months of age to prevent re-infestation.
Worms often re-infest pups so it is necessary to treat the puppy itself and all other contact dogs, reduce environmental contamination by daily disposal of droppings.
